Immepip dihydrobromide is a H3 agonist. Immepip dihydrobromide can reduce cortical histamine release. Immepip dihydrobromide can be used for the research of neurological diseases.

| Description | This compound belongs to the class of organic compounds known as aralkylamines. These are alkylamines in which the alkyl group is substituted at one carbon atom by an aromatic hydrocarbyl group. |
